About American Express

American Express (Amex) is a global financial services company known for providing a wide range of payment solutions. Its services include issuing credit and charge cards, as well as providing payment processing and merchant services. Amex cards are widely accepted across various sectors such as retail, travel, and dining, and are particularly known for their premium offerings, including the American Express Platinum and Gold cards. The company offers benefits such as travel rewards, access to exclusive events, and personalized customer service. In addition to consumer cards, American Express provides solutions for businesses, including expense management tools and corporate cards. It also offers financial products tailored to different consumer segments, such as rewards programs and balance transfer options. As a leader in the payments industry, American Express has expanded its digital solutions and online payment services, aiming to create seamless and secure transactions for both consumers and businesses​

What to do when you cannot repay your loan on time 

Missing a loan repayment deadline can be stressful, but how you respond matters more than the setback itself. The best first step is to contact your lender early, explain your situation, and explore available options such as extensions, restructuring, or revised payment plans. Ignoring the issue can lead to added fees, damaged credit history, or aggressive recovery actions. By acting quickly and communicating honestly, borrowers can often reduce the impact and work toward a manageable solution.
